Understanding White Copy Paper
White copy paper usually features a smooth finish and is frequently made from cellulose fibers. The most common type of white paper used in printers and copiers is referred to as "bond paper," which is valued for its ink compatibility and versatility.

Choosing the suitable white copy paper can substantially impact the quality of printed materials. Here are some finest practices:
1. Recognize Your Needs
What is the purpose of the file? If you're printing expert documents, think about utilizing premium copy paper that enhances the general discussion. For daily printing, fundamental copy paper is enough.
2. Examine Printer Compatibility
Before purchasing, examine the requirements of your printer. Some printers perform much better with particular weights and surfaces. Using the advised paper can avoid jams and misprints.
3. Think About Environmental Impact
Select recycled paper whenever possible. Numerous brand names now offer premium recycled alternatives that are ecologically friendly without jeopardizing on print quality.
4. Test Samples
If you're unsure which paper type to choose, request samples from suppliers. Testing different weights and surfaces can help you make an educated decision about what works best for your needs.
5. Shop Properly
To maintain the quality of your paper, store it in a cool, dry place. Humidity can cause paper to warp or end up being fragile, affecting print performance.
